๐๐ฒ๐ ๐๐ฒ๐ฎ๐๐๐ฟ๐ฒ๐ ๐ฎ๐ป๐ฑ ๐ฆ๐ฝ๐ฒ๐ฐ๐ถ๐ณ๐ถ๐ฐ๐ฎ๐๐ถ๐ผ๐ป๐
When considering used welding machines, it is important to understand their key features and specifications. The specifications can greatly influence the machine's performance and suitability for specific applications.
Key specifications include:
1. Welding Process Type
- Types include MIG, TIG, Stick, and Flux-Cored welding.
- Each type has unique benefits, depending on the application.
2. Output Current Range
- Typically ranges from 30A to 500A, allowing for versatility in welding tasks.
- Higher output current is suitable for thicker materials.
3. Duty Cycle
- Indicates the percentage of time the machine can operate continuously.
- Common duty cycles range from 20% to 100%, affecting overall productivity.
4. Voltage Input
- Standard input voltages include 110V, 220V, and 480V.
- Compatibility with the power supply is essential for operation.
5. Weight
- Machines can weigh anywhere from 40 lbs to over 500 lbs.
- Weight can impact portability and ease of use on job sites.
6. Cooling System
- Machines may have air or water-cooling systems.
- Effective cooling enhances performance during prolonged use.
7. Controls and Settings
- Digital displays and manual controls for adjusting settings.
- Enhanced user interfaces improve operator efficiency.
8. Safety Features
- Includes automatic shut-off, thermal protection, and overload alarms.
- Essential for ensuring safe operation in various environments.
Understanding these specifications allows B2B buyers to select machines that meet their operational needs while maximizing efficiency.

๐ฃ๐ฟ๐ผ๐ฑ๐๐ฐ๐ ๐ฉ๐ฎ๐ฟ๐ถ๐ฎ๐ป๐๐ ๐ฎ๐ป๐ฑ ๐ฆ๐๐ฏ๐ฐ๐ฎ๐๐ฒ๐ด๐ผ๐ฟ๐ถ๐ฒ๐
Used welding machines come in various forms, allowing businesses to choose models that best fit their specific needs.
MIG Welding Machines: These machines are popular for their ease of use and versatility. They are ideal for welding thin materials and are widely used in automotive and fabrication industries.
TIG Welding Machines: Known for producing high-quality welds, TIG machines are suitable for precision work. They are commonly used in industries such as aerospace and artistic metalwork.
Stick Welding Machines: These machines are robust and can be used on dirty or rusty metals. They are often utilized in construction and repair applications.
Multi-Process Welding Machines: These versatile machines can handle multiple welding processes including MIG, TIG, and Stick. They are suitable for businesses that require flexibility in their welding operations.
